Ross McCullam was jailed for a minimum of 23 years for murdering 23-year-old Megan Newborough
A murderer jailed for strangling his girlfriend could see his sentence increased at the Court of Appeal.with a minimum term of 23 years for killing Megan Newborough, 23, at his home in Leicestershire, on 6 August 2021.Solicitor General Michael Tomlinson has referred the sentence as it "appears unduly lenient".Ms Newborough met McCullam at work at the Ibstock Brick factory
McCullam attacked her and strangled her to death before fetching a carving knife to cut her throat, in what the prosecution said was an attempt to decapitate her. He then attempted to cover up the murder by leaving phone messages professing love and supposed concern for her.
